原创作者: hotdog   阅读:2056次   评论:0条   更新时间:2011-05-26    
原来都是通过将war包部署到web容器的方式来运行Hudson。

由于服务器有限制所以换了一种方式,使用RedHat的rpm安装启动。

可以到下面的网址去下载最新的rpm
http://pkg.hudson-labs.org/redhat/

安装步骤
1.以root身份登录
2.分别执行:
wget -O /etc/yum.repos.d/hudson.repo http://pkg.hudson-labs.org/redhat/hudson.repo
rpm --import http://pkg.hudson-labs.org/redhat/hudson-labs.org.key
3.将hudson-1.388-1.1.noarch.rpm上传到服务器
4.执行rpm -ivh hudson-1.388-1.1.noarch.rpm

默认配置
启动脚本:/etc/init.d/hudson
配置文件:/etc/sysconfig/hudson
日志文件:/var/log/hudson/hudson.log
HUDSON_HOME:/var/lib/hudson
War文件:/usr/lib/hudson/hudson.war

备注
如果想自定义配置,如HUDSON_HOME,可以修改/etc/sysconfig/hudson文件。需要注意的是HUDSON_USER这个配置指定哪个用户来执行Hudson命令,我指定的是root。如果指定的用户权限不够,则会抛出Permission denied或者java.io.FileNotFoundException的异常。

启动系统
/etc/init.d/hudson start


评论 共 0 条 请登录后发表评论

发表评论

您还没有登录,请您登录后再发表评论

文章信息

Global site tag (gtag.js) - Google Analytics